Robert Noyce became a cofounder of Intel Corporation and a co-inventor of the Integrated Circuit. Noyce played a vaLuable Function inside the mass manufacturing of Semiconductors, the advent of reminiscence Chips and the invention of the Microprocessor. Noyce is taken into consideration to be one of the pioneers of Silicon Valley, both for his achievements and his laid-again control fashion, which typified later begin-ups.
After receiving a Ph.D. In physics from the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, Noyce spent a short period at Philco Corporation before leaving to Join William Shockley at Shockley SemIconductor. Shockley turned into the co-inventor of the Transistor, however he turned into a difficult man to paintings for. Noyce and 7 colleagues left the lab to begin up Fairchild Semiconductor in 1957, where they helped pave the manner for mass-produced semiconductors.
Noyce and his colleague, Gordon Moore, left Fairchild in 1968 and founded Intel. During Noyce and Moore’s time at Intel, the company created the reminiscence chip market and invented microProcessors, making both guys extraordinarily wealthy. Noyce died in 1990 at the age of sixty two.
